A data analysis agent combines with artificial intelligence (AI) by leveraging AI techniques—such as machine learning, natural language processing (NLP), and predictive analytics—to automate, enhance, and interpret data-driven insights. The agent acts as an intelligent interface that can collect, process, and analyze data from various sources, then provide actionable recommendations or automated responses based on the analysis.
Here’s how the combination typically works:
Data Collection and Integration: The agent gathers structured and unstructured data from multiple sources such as databases, APIs, logs, or user inputs. AI helps in identifying relevant data sources and integrating them efficiently.
Intelligent Data Processing: Using AI models, especially machine learning algorithms, the agent can clean, transform, and preprocess data. For example, it can detect anomalies, fill in missing values, or categorize data automatically.
Natural Language Understanding: With NLP, the agent can understand and respond to user queries in natural language. For instance, a business user might ask, “What were the sales trends last quarter?” and the agent can interpret the question, query the relevant datasets, and deliver an answer using AI-driven analysis.
Predictive and Prescriptive Analytics: AI enables the agent to go beyond descriptive analysis by forecasting future trends (predictive) or suggesting actions (prescriptive). For example, it could predict customer churn or recommend marketing strategies based on historical performance data.
Automation and Continuous Learning: The agent can automate routine data analysis tasks and improve over time by learning from new data and user interactions. This is achieved through techniques like reinforcement learning or continuous model training.
Example:
Imagine a retail company using a data analysis agent to monitor sales performance. The agent collects real-time sales data from stores and online platforms. Using AI, it identifies that a particular product’s sales are dropping in specific regions. It then automatically generates a report, highlights potential causes (like seasonal trends or competitor activity), and suggests targeted promotions. The sales team can interact with the agent using natural language, asking questions like “Why are sales down in the Northeast?” and receiving AI-powered insights instantly.
In the context of cloud computing, platforms like Tencent Cloud offer services that support such intelligent data analysis agents. For instance, Tencent Cloud provides machine learning platforms, data warehousing solutions, natural language processing APIs, and big data processing tools that enable the deployment and scaling of intelligent data analysis agents efficiently. These services help businesses build, train, and deploy AI models that power advanced data analysis capabilities.